Improved Operational Efficiency

One of the primary benefits of field service automation is its ability to significantly boost operational efficiency. By automating routine tasks and streamlining processes, businesses can free up valuable time and resources that were previously spent on manual data entry, scheduling, and dispatching.

Automated Scheduling and Dispatching

Field service automation platforms often come equipped with advanced scheduling algorithms that can optimize routes and assign jobs to technicians based on their location, availability, and skillset. This not only reduces the time spent on manual planning but also ensures that the right technician is sent to the right job at the right time.

For instance, a company like ServiceMax uses AI-powered scheduling to optimize routes and reduce travel time for field technicians. According to their case studies, this approach has resulted in significant reductions in fuel consumption and carbon emissions while improving overall service delivery times.

Real-time Job Updates and Tracking

Another crucial aspect of field service automation is real-time job tracking and updates. These systems allow both dispatchers and customers to stay informed about the status of ongoing jobs through mobile apps or dedicated portals.

By providing real-time visibility into job progress, customers can better plan their day around scheduled appointments, reducing the likelihood of missed appointments or rescheduling. For businesses, this transparency builds trust and enhances customer satisfaction scores.

Enhanced Customer Experience

Field service automation doesn’t just benefit businesses; it also leads to improved experiences for end-users. Here are some ways automation contributes to better customer interactions:

Predictive Maintenance

Many modern field service automation platforms incorporate predictive maintenance capabilities. These systems use historical data and machine learning algorithms to identify potential equipment failures before they occur.

By scheduling proactive maintenance visits, businesses can prevent unexpected downtime and minimize the need for emergency repairs. This approach not only saves money but also improves customer satisfaction by ensuring consistent service delivery.

Personalized Communication

Automation allows for more personalized communication with customers. Through automated notifications and tailored messaging, businesses can keep customers informed about appointment schedules, estimated arrival times, and any changes to the planned visit.

This level of personalization helps build trust and demonstrates a commitment to customer care, potentially leading to increased loyalty and positive reviews.

Cost Savings and Resource Optimization

Implementing field service automation can lead to substantial cost savings and improved resource utilization. Let’s examine some specific areas where automation delivers tangible benefits:

Reduced Travel Time and Fuel Consumption

By optimizing routes and minimizing unnecessary travel, field service automation can significantly reduce fuel consumption and lower transportation costs. According to a study by IFS, companies that implemented field service management software saw a reduction of up to 20% in travel-related expenses.

Minimized Inventory Costs

Automated inventory management features in field service platforms help ensure that the right parts are available at the right time. This eliminates the need for overstocking, which can lead to substantial cost savings, especially for businesses dealing with high-value spare parts.

Efficient Resource Allocation

Automation enables businesses to make data-driven decisions about resource allocation. By analyzing historical data and current workload, companies can better predict staffing needs and avoid over- or under-staffing during peak periods.

This approach not only optimizes costs but also ensures that skilled technicians are utilized effectively, potentially leading to higher first-time fix rates and reduced repeat visits.

Data-Driven Decision Making

Field service automation provides businesses with unprecedented access to data and insights. This wealth of information can be leveraged to drive continuous improvement and strategic decision-making within the organization.

Performance Metrics and KPIs

Modern automation platforms offer a wide range of performance metrics and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). These can include things like:

  • First-time fix rate
  • Mean time to resolve (MTTR)
  • Customer satisfaction scores
  • Technician productivity

By monitoring these metrics over time, businesses can identify trends, spot areas for improvement, and make data-backed decisions to refine their operations.

Predictive Analytics

Advanced field service automation systems often incorporate predictive analytics capabilities. These tools can forecast future demand, identify potential bottlenecks in the workflow, and suggest strategies to mitigate risks.

For example, a utility company might use predictive analytics to anticipate potential power outages during extreme weather conditions, allowing them to proactively schedule maintenance visits and minimize disruptions to customers.

Integration and Scalability

One of the key advantages of modern field service automation solutions is their ability to integrate seamlessly with existing systems and scale as the business grows. This flexibility ensures that the investment in automation pays dividends well into the future.

API Connectivity

Most contemporary field service automation platforms offer robust API connectivity. This allows businesses to integrate the system with other enterprise applications such as CRM systems, ERP software, and even social media channels.

By maintaining a single source of truth across all these platforms, businesses can ensure consistency in data and streamline their overall operations.

Cloud-Based Architecture

Cloud-based field service automation solutions offer unparalleled scalability and accessibility. As a business expands geographically or increases its service offerings, cloud-based systems can easily accommodate these changes without requiring expensive hardware upgrades or complex IT infrastructure modifications.
